    Jon Paul Morosi of FOXSports.com hears that the Twins might consider trading Ben Revere.

    It would be a strange move, given that they just cleared room in center field for Revere by dealing Denard Span. Even more bizarre is that Morosi says they would be looking for a center fielder in return. Revere has zero power but batted .294 with 40 steals in 2012 and also offers great defense. He's under team control through 2017.
